Comfortable, confident Naz Reid takes on leadership role off Timberwolves bench

  • Naz Reid embraces his leadership role with the Timberwolves as he helps younger teammates like Terrence Shannon Jr. and Rob Dillingham develop their game.
  • Reid signed a five-year, $125 million deal, which he claims allows him to 'breathe' and focus solely on the game.
  • Timberwolves Coach Chris Finch expressed confidence in Reid and Donte DiVincenzo, stating they are 'like two starter-caliber players' for the bench.
  • Reid enjoys mentoring younger players, stating, 'It’s fun and becoming the teacher.

Comfortable, confident Naz Reid takes on leadership role off Timberwolves bench

Anthony Edwards, Jaden McDaniels and Naz Reid have developed a close bond during their time with the Timberwolves. Asked why the trio jibes so well, Edwards pointed to their personalities. Edwards is himself in any setting. McDaniels is “super quiet.” As for Reid? “Outgoing around the right people,” Edwards said. And, perhaps, when the situation calls for it.
